Gary Shuster
Gary is the innovator’s innovator. He has received over 250 U.S. patents since 2004, or about one patent per month. He’s an innovation speaker, writer, coach, attorney and consultant who has extensive personal and professional experience in the lifecycle of patents, from crafting, improving, and fighting for them to licensing them, maximizing their exit strategies, and protecting them.
Gary takes the same innovative approach to legal problems. One of Gary’s first patents was a technological method to cheaply and quickly solve a legal problem.
